Solution for 2x+9=71-8x equation:


Simplifying
2x + 9 = 71 + -8x

Reorder the terms:
9 + 2x = 71 + -8x

Solving
9 + 2x = 71 + -8x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'8x' to each side of the equation.
9 + 2x + 8x = 71 + -8x + 8x

Combine like terms: 2x + 8x = 10x
9 + 10x = 71 + -8x + 8x

Combine like terms: -8x + 8x = 0
9 + 10x = 71 + 0
9 + 10x = 71

Add '-9' to each side of the equation.
9 + -9 + 10x = 71 + -9

Combine like terms: 9 + -9 = 0
0 + 10x = 71 + -9
10x = 71 + -9

Combine like terms: 71 + -9 = 62
10x = 62

Divide each side by '10'.
x = 6.2

Simplifying
x = 6.2
